WebThe crystalline domains are typically referred to as the “hard” phase and the amorphous domains as the “soft” phase. While both phases contribute to the overall physical and mechanical properties of a TPE, some key properties may be associated with one phase or the other thereby guiding the selection or design of a TPE compound. WebSome examples of amorphous solids are glass, rubber, pitch, many plastic etc. Quartz is an example of a crystalline solid which has regular order of the arrangement of SiO 4 tetrahedra. If quartz is melted and the melt is cooled rapidly enough to avoid crystallization an amorphous solid called glass is obtained.

WebAug 14, 2024 · Summary. Some substances form crystalline solids consisting of particles in a very organized structure; others form amorphous (noncrystalline) solids with an internal structure that is not ordered. The main types of crystalline solids are ionic solids, metallic solids, covalent network solids, and molecular solids. WebSep 7, 2024 · Amorphous polymers are softer, have lower melting points, and are penetrated more by solvents than are their crystalline counterparts. Glassy and Rubber States At low temperatures molecular motion in an amorphous region is restricted to molecular vibrations, but the chains cannot rotate or move in space (the worms are frozen and cannot move).
